About Anna Osello
Anna Osello is a scholar working on Geology, Building and Construction, Management, Monitoring, Policy and Law, Computer Networks and Communications and Electrical and Electronic Engineering, having authored 71 papers that have together received 636 indexed citations. Recurring topics across this work include 3D Surveying and Cultural Heritage (34 papers), BIM and Construction Integration (26 papers), Urban Planning and Valuation (11 papers), 3D Modeling in Geospatial Applications (11 papers), Smart Grid Energy Management (6 papers), Building Energy and Comfort Optimization (5 papers), Remote Sensing and LiDAR Applications (4 papers) and Green IT and Sustainability (4 papers). The work is most often cited by research in Geology (261 citations), Space and Planetary Science (44 citations), Building and Construction (310 citations), Conservation (69 citations) and Environmental Engineering (69 citations). Anna Osello has collaborated with scholars based in Italy, France and Germany. Frequent co-authors include Andrea Acquaviva, Edoardo Patti, Enrico Macii, Manlio Del Giudice, Vittorio Verda, Lorenzo Bottaccioli, Francesco Brundu, Marco Jahn, Elisa Guelpa and Alessandro Aliberti. Their work appears in journals such as IT Professional, Sustainability, Buildings, Energy Efficiency and IEEE Transactions on Industrial Informatics.
